I'm not sure about that particular trick of Mayhem 20.  I believe there was actually someone who mentioned in the Tehcnical or Game Help forum that they didn't like that trick much, since they found it "cheap" in the sense that it's so different from what the rest of the game has taught you about blockers.  In that sense, it's really not too different from the trick in question here.  Indeed, one can argue the geoo89 trick here actually is less surprising given the Mayhem 20 trick is already relatively well-known.

And in my e-mail to you weeks ago, I already explained how most tricks and even some glitches can, at least in theory, come about by probing deeper into the game mechanics more precisely, and finding conditions where your current understanding of the game fail to give you a definite prediction, or finding a fine point about the game mechanics that you can recreate using a different, previously unthought of combination of moves.  (Though at least for glitches, in practice their discovery often has a serendipital element.)

One might argue though that, perhaps with the Mayhem 20 trick, one is more likely to accidentally stumbled upon the discovery than here, where you specifically have to make a move that, had the trick not work, the move would be completely counterproductive.

On the other hand, surely at least a few of us must have observed that when you attempt to free a blocker by bashing underneath, you don't always have to remove the entire swath of ground underneath both feet of the blocker in order to free the blocker.  This observation can conceivably lead one down logically to a path resulting in discovery of the trick used for geoo89's level.

So, in short, I disagree that the trick cannot be worked out.  All the more evident when in fact this level has already been solved by a couple of people as compared with a few other levels, in particular level 10.  Certainly compared with something more bizarre like the miner glitch, this is at most a borderline glitch, and hardly defies expectations.
